What Are Stainless Steel Load Cells?
Stainless steel load cells are force measurement sensors built using corrosion-resistant stainless steel materials. They convert applied mechanical force into electrical signals using strain gauge technology.
These devices are specifically designed for environments where hygiene, durability, and environmental resistance are essential.
Key Characteristics:
- Corrosion-resistant stainless steel housing
- High accuracy strain gauge technology
- Waterproof and dustproof sealing (IP-rated designs)
- Excellent long-term stability
- Suitable for harsh industrial environments
These features make them ideal for both indoor and outdoor industrial applications.

Types of Stainless Steel Load Cells
Different designs support various industrial applications.
Shear Beam Load Cells
Common in platform scales and industrial weighing systems requiring stability and accuracy.
Compression Load Cells
Used in tanks, silos, and hopper weighing systems under heavy load conditions.
Tension Load Cells
Designed for hanging scales, cranes, and suspended load measurement applications.
Single Point Load Cells
Ideal for compact weighing platforms and retail or industrial scales.

Installation & Maintenance Best Practices
Correct installation plays a major role in performance consistency.
Recommended Practices:
- Ensure correct alignment and load distribution
- Avoid lateral forces or side loading
- Use certified mounting accessories
- Protect cables from mechanical stress
- Perform scheduled calibration checks
These practices help maintain accuracy and extend product lifespan.
